How IQ Assessments Are Administered to Young children
IQ tests for children is usually a very carefully structured system that requires specialized education and managed environments. The evaluation typically will take area inside of a quiet, distraction-free of charge place with an experienced psychologist or trained examiner. Kids are generally examined independently rather then in teams to ensure accurate outcomes and appropriate consideration to each child's demands.
The testing procedure typically spans a single to a few hours, with regards to the child's age and a focus span. Examiners usually break the session into smaller sized segments with breaks to stop fatigue, as tired children may well not conduct at their finest. The environment is intended to be cozy and non-threatening, with examiners skilled to put children at relieve when keeping standardized processes.
Through the assessment, little ones interact with numerous tasks which will appear to be games or puzzles. These things to do are thoroughly intended to measure unique facets of cognitive capability with no youngster feeling pressured or informed they are being formally evaluated. The examiner observes don't just the child's responses but in addition their issue-resolving strategy, notice span, and response to challenges.
The Gold Common: Wechsler Intelligence Scales
The most widely identified and Formal IQ examination for youngsters would be the Wechsler Intelligence Scale for youngsters, at the moment in its fifth version (WISC-V). This extensive evaluation is considered the gold common in pediatric intelligence tests and it is recognized by faculties, psychologists, and academic establishments throughout the world.
The WISC-V evaluates small children aged 6 to 16 decades and measures five Key cognitive domains: verbal comprehension, visual spatial processing, fluid reasoning, Functioning memory, and processing velocity. Each domain is made up of various subtests that assess certain cognitive techniques. For instance, the verbal comprehension area could include vocabulary exams and similarities duties, when the Visible spatial portion could involve block design and style troubles and Visible puzzles.
For young children aged 2 to 7 many years, the Wechsler Preschool and Primary Scale of Intelligence (WPPSI-IV) serves since the equivalent assessment Device. This Model is specially tailored for youthful notice spans and developmental levels, incorporating extra Participate in-based actions whilst sustaining rigorous measurement requirements.
The Stanford-Binet Intelligence Scales symbolize Yet another respected choice, especially helpful for children with exceptional abilities or developmental delays. This exam can evaluate persons from age 2 via adulthood and offers comprehensive analysis throughout five cognitive elements.
Why Private Elementary Educational facilities Involve IQ Screening
Private elementary schools significantly have to have IQ screening as component in their admissions approach for numerous interconnected reasons. Generally, these institutions use cognitive assessments to make sure tutorial compatibility amongst incoming students as well as their rigorous curricula. Educational facilities with accelerated or specialised applications really need to discover kids who will deal with Highly developed coursework with no turning into confused or disengaged.
The selective nature of many non-public educational institutions means they get more apps than available spots. IQ scores deliver an objective evaluate that assists admissions committees make challenging conclusions when choosing amongst in the same way competent candidates. Compared with grades or teacher suggestions, that may differ appreciably between faculties and educators, standardized IQ scores give a consistent metric for comparison.
Several personal educational facilities also use IQ testing to produce well balanced lecture rooms and inform their teaching techniques. Knowledge the cognitive profiles of incoming learners enables educators to tailor instruction strategies, establish small children who might require further assist, and realize individuals that would reap the benefits of enrichment possibilities. This info-driven strategy aids educational institutions optimize Every single scholar's probable when retaining their educational expectations.
Moreover, some personal faculties specialize in serving gifted students or Those people with precise Finding out profiles. For these institutions, IQ tests is important for figuring out children who'd thrive in their specialised environments. Educational institutions focused on gifted instruction generally search for students scoring in the highest percentiles, while others could possibly search for certain cognitive styles that align with their academic philosophy.
